User photo

Salvador Dali Museum

About

The Salvador Dalí Museum is an art museum in St. Petersburg, Florida, United States, dedicated to the works of Salvador Dalí. It is located on the downtown St. Petersburg waterfront by 5th Avenue Southeast, Bay Shore Drive, and Dan Wheldon Way.